What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your highest priority when deciding what to wear on board. Loose, breathable clothing is a smart choice, as are flat, slip-on shoes.
  • Most of us have he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of sitting. To minimize your risk on board, drink plenty of water, consider wearing compression tights or socks and move your legs and feet often.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to New Ross?
It's all about being organised. We've pulled together some helpful hints for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Watch out New Ross, here you come:

  • Be sure to keep your passport and travel documents easily accessible. They're the first things you'll be asked to present to airport security.
  • After that, both you and your carry-on bag must be X-rayed. To make the process quick and painless, take off anything that is likely to set the alarm off. Personal belongings like your belt, coat and headph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, tablet and any other electronic devices also need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Remember to remove gels and liquids from your hand luggage. They often need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• It's also possible you'll be required to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a smart idea.
  • Airlines won't allow any sharp items or pocket knives in your carry-on bagg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them safely in your checked luggage.
